בשפת HTML, אטריבוט אני מגדיר כרכיב קוד בתוך תג מבנה.
רכיב קוד זה הוא למעשה תכונה שיכולה לקבל ערך אחד לפחות בכדי לגרום לתג המבנה להופיע בצורה מסוימת או אף להתנהג בצורה מסוימת (בהתאם לתג).
לפי דעתי, נדרש להכיר הכרות יסודית או בסיסית את שפת המבנה שפת HTML, או כל שפת מבנה דומה אחרת, בכדי להבין בצורה יעילה את המונח או לפחות את יישומו במובן של קידום אתרים.
דוגמה לתג עם אטריבוט בשפת HTML
<div id="id_1"> </div>
במקרה זה ישנם תגיי div
(תג פתיחה ותג סגירה) אשר קיבלו את האטריבוט id
עם הערך id_1
; בעזרת ערך זה נוכל לסמן את המבנה הזה בצורה ייחודית ולגרום לו להופיע בצורות שונות כמו למשל לתת לו צבע רקע.
הערות כלליות
סוגים שונים של שפת מחשב מארגנים ערכים בצורות שונות (כגון משתנה-ערך, מפתח-ערך, תכונה-ערך, מאפיין-ערך); בהתאמה ל:
- Key-value
- Property-value
- Attribute-value
- וכדומה